Output 51333e1cc6926041e48cfedfeaa47e069b64bc2bde42d2e1b62e27a58ff4c78a:1

value
997380095
script pubkey
OP_0 OP_PUSHBYTES_20 ec21594b13704899835ec3e16973f5970cb261e8
address
ltc1qass4jjcnwpyfnq67c0skjul4juxtyc0gkazzmf
transaction
51333e1cc6926041e48cfedfeaa47e069b64bc2bde42d2e1b62e27a58ff4c78a
spent
true